@lint_re_check(
# Match std::to_string() or unqualified to_string() calls
# The esphome namespace has "using std::to_string;" so unqualified calls resolve to std::to_string
# Use negative lookbehind to avoid matching:
# - Function definitions: "const char *to_string(" or "std::string to_string("
# - Method definitions: "Class::to_string("
# - Method calls: ".to_string(" or "->to_string("
# - Other identifiers: "_to_string("
r"(?<![*&.\w>:])to_string\s*\(" + CPP_RE_EOL,
include=cpp_include,
exclude=[
# Vendored library
"esphome/components/http_request/httplib.h",
# Deprecated helpers that return std::string
"esphome/core/helpers.cpp",
# The using declaration itself
"esphome/core/helpers.h",
# Test fixtures - not production embedded code
"tests/integration/fixtures/*",
],
)
def lint_no_std_to_string(fname, match):
return (
f"{highlight('std::to_string()')} allocates heap memory. On long-running embedded "
f"devices, repeated heap allocations fragment memory over time.\n"
f"Please use {highlight('snprintf()')} with a stack buffer instead.\n"
f"\n"
f"Buffer sizes and format specifiers:\n"
f" uint8_t/int8_t: 4 chars - %u / %d (or PRIu8/PRId8)\n"
f" uint16_t/int16_t: 6 chars - %u / %d (or PRIu16/PRId16)\n"
f" uint32_t/int32_t: 11 chars - %" + "PRIu32 / %" + "PRId32\n"
" uint64_t/int64_t: 21 chars - %" + "PRIu64 / %" + "PRId64\n"
f" float/double: 24 chars - %.8g (15 digits + sign + decimal + e+XXX)\n"
f" 317 chars - %f (for DBL_MAX: 309 int digits + decimal + 6 frac + sign)\n"
f"\n"
f"For sensor values, use value_accuracy_to_buf() from helpers.h.\n"
f'Example: char buf[11]; sn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"%" PRIu32, value);\n'
f"(If strictly necessary, add `{highlight('// NOLINT')}` to the end of the line)"
)
